A new generation of intelligent quotation

As part of v46, Lantek is introducing a major evolution of its iQuoting solution, bringing significant advances across every stage of the quotation process.

A redesigned part import assistant supports both individual 3D parts and complete assemblies, providing tools to detect and manage geometries, manipulate layers and prepare imported data for quotation. Integrated feasibility rules then evaluate whether the geometries can be manufactured using the available technologies and production capabilities. Combined with deeper and more configurable calculation methods and predefined work plans, these capabilities bring manufacturing knowledge into the quotation process earlier, allowing manufacturers to represent their own production logic, manufacturing routes, resources and costing criteria more accurately when estimating increasingly complex projects.

Many of these capabilities are supported by KAI, Lantek’s AI technology, which assists users by analysing manufacturing information, interpreting design data and automating complex decision-making throughout the quotation workflow. Rather than replacing engineering expertise, KAI helps companies to prepare accurate quotations more quickly while reducing manual effort and improving consistency.

In addition, the integration with the broader Lantek software portfolio has also been strengthened, enabling a smoother transition from an accepted quotation into downstream manufacturing processes.

Advanced punching programming and NOS optimisation

Lantek Expert v46 takes the programming of punching machines and combined punch-cut technologies to a new level.

New options streamline and automate the programming of individual parts and complete nests, while supporting advanced machining strategies and complex combinations of operations.

A key development is the extension of NOS (Nesting Optimisation Service) to punching machines. Previously available only for cutting technologies, Lantek’s most advanced nesting engine now brings its material optimisation capabilities to punching environments, extending advanced optimisation across a broader range of sheet metal technologies.

Extending automation across the production workflow

As automated loading, unloading and material storage systems become increasingly important in sheet metal production, Lantek is developing new technology to support the growing number and complexity of these projects.

The newly redesigned Stackmaster delivers a more intuitive and visual palletising programming experience, fully integrated within Lantek Expert. At the same time, Lantek is extending its capabilities for automatic storage systems, with technology designed to connect and coordinate cutting machines and warehouses while managing the related MES workflows, production processes and material inventory as part of a complete automation flow.

New possibilities for tube and structural steel manufacturing

Lantek Flex3D v46 incorporates a new module for designing tube-to-tube connections directly within 3D assemblies.

Users can create and adapt these connections from an extensive library of parametric joint types commonly used in industry. By integrating these capabilities into Lantek Flex3D, recurrent manufacturing-oriented design work can be completed without returning to an external CAD application.

The solution also introduces the unbending of bent tubes during 3D file import, automatically generating the developed geometry required for cutting and manufacturing preparation.

For structural steel and profile fabricators, Lantek v46 adds a new integration with Tekla PowerFab, linking its MES-MRP environment with Lantek’s programming solutions. Together with the established StruMIS MRP Connector, this broadens Lantek’s integration ecosystem and gives manufacturers greater flexibility to work with their preferred specialised production management platforms.

More flexible bending decisions on the shop floor

Lantek v46 introduces a more advanced integration between Lantek Bend and the MES manufacturing workflow.

The system can calculate and retain alternative bending solutions for the same part across different press brakes. For each alternative, manufacturers can assess in advance whether the bending operation is technically feasible on that machine, together with the machine-specific tooling, setup and process information required for production.

This allows the final press brake to be selected closer to execution, based on actual machine availability, workload or tooling conditions. Production teams gain greater flexibility to respond to changing workshop priorities while retaining the validated technical information for the selected machine.

Expanded machine connectivity across the workshop

Lantek continues to extend its Machine Connectivity capabilities beyond cutting equipment, adding support for press brakes and other types of CNC machines.

Lantek’s Control Panel has also been renewed with a redesigned user interface. The new design improves the organisation, clarity and readability of machine information, complemented by a smoother and more responsive visualisation of real-time machine events.

By enabling a broader range of production assets to feed reliable data into Lantek MES, Control Panel and Lantek Analytics, this expansion reinforces Lantek’s multi-vendor approach, improves real-time visibility across the workshop and supports more accurate OEE calculations and other key production indicators.
